Electronic Theatre provides an in-depth analysis of the European retail release version of Lionhead Studio's blockbuster Xbox360 exclusive release, Fable II.

...the letdowns of the first Fable are considered water under-the-bridge. The game, despite failing to live-up to the complexity that had been promised, was considered to be a worthwhile adventure through a pleasantly constructed world, nonetheless. And so, with Fable II, Lionhead Studios have been given the chance to expand this world; to create a believable Albion for the player to create peace, or wreak havoc. And throughout all of the adventures within, there’s no denying that Molyneux and Lionhead Studios have acknowledged the fan’s criticisms; showing without equal that which comes from planting little acorns...
